Ro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new, durable covering to protect a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ing old materials, repairing any underlying damage, and carefully installing new roofing components such as shingles, tiles, or metal panels. The goal is to ensure the roof provides reliable protection against weather elements, enhances the property's appearance, and increases its overall value. Homeowners seeking a roof replacement often work with local contractors who have experience in handling different roofing systems and materials suitable for various property types.
This service is essential for addressing a range of roofing problems that can compromise a home's safety and integrity. Common issues include extensive damage from severe weather, persistent leaks, missing or broken shingles, and widespread wear and tear from age. When repairs are no longer sufficient to restore the roof’s functionality, or when the roof has reached the end of its lifespan, a replacement becomes necessary. A new roof can also impro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reducing drafts, which can be particularly beneficial in climates with harsh winters like those in Baraboo, WI.

The overview below groups typical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Baraboo,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of repairs in Baraboo range from $250 to $600, covering issues like small leaks or damaged shingles. Most routine repairs fall within this middle range, making it a common expense for many homeowners.
Partial Replacements - When parts of a roof need replacement, costs generally range from $1,000 to $3,500 depending on the size and materials used. Larger, more complex partial projects can exceed this range but are less common.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ements for average-sized homes usually c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Projects in this range are typical, while very large or high-end installations can go higher.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ate roof replacements or those involving premium materials can reach $15,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and often involve specialized design or structural considerations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a contractor for roof repl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ects in the Baraboo area or nearby communities. Homeowners should inquire about how many roof replacements a service provider has completed that resemble their specific needs, such as the size, style, or particular challenges of the roof. An experienced contractor is more likely to understand local building conditions and common issues, which can contribute to a smoother process and a more durable result.
Clear, written expectations are essential to ensure that both the homeowner and the service provider are aligned on the scope of work, materials, and responsibilities.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line all aspects of the project, including the work to be done, materials used,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a useful reference throughout the project, fostering transparency and trust.
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a reliable local cont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to ask service providers for references from previous clients with similar projects and to verify their reputation through reviews or testimonials. Additionally, a contractor’s responsiveness and willingness to answer questions clearly can reveal their level of professionalism and commitment to customer satisfaction. What are the signs that a roof needs replacement? Indicators include missing or damaged shingles, persistent leaks, and widespread aging or deterioration of roofing materials.
How do local contractors handle roof replacements? They typically assess the roof’s condition, remove the existing roofing, and install new materials according to industry standards.
What types of roofing materials are available for replacement?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, wood shakes, and tile,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
Is it necessary to prepare the property before a roof replacement? Yes, clearing the area around the home and protecting landscaping can help facilitate a smoother installation process.
